There’s a bitterness to Linderman as if the bomb were not only destined but welcomed as some kind of revenge on the world. Nathan said his father was his hero, I suppose he remembers him from before the disillusion set in whereas Peter being that much younger cannot.

Again, very difficult to comment on that without spoilers, but this was when I started to wonder what happened to the earlier generation - Linderman, Angela, Petrelli Senior - to make them what they are. And yes, Nathan's pov and Peter's pov on their father being that different might very well be connected to their age, but in Nathan's case there is also restrospective guilt and consequent glorification at work. You'll note that Nathan says "(Pa) would have me committed for even considering this insanity" to Linderman. This would be the same Petrelli Senior who worked with Linderman-the-mobster for years and years and years, and even if that started as fellow idealists, it was followed by a lot of crime. But I think Peter was dead on when he said to Nathan, in "Six Months Ago", that if he went to court against their father, "you'll never forgive yourself". (Regarding Peter, it's telling his objection wasn't "think of what that would do to Dad" but relating to how it would affect Nathan.) There is a deleted scene for 6MA on the DVDS which is a longer version of the scene where Nathan tells Peter their father died. (Which, remember, was by suicide, and Nathan knows this, though he doesn't tell Peter, that's left to Angela in the second episode of s1.) Said scene makes it even more explicit Nathan did blame himself for his father's death. Which I think makes for projecting in the Linderman scene from "Landslide".
